BlackRock Bitcoin ETF Reaches $80 Billion AUM Milestone

BY Solomon M.·2 MIN READ·JULY 11, 2025

BlackRock’s iShares Bitcoin Trust has achieved $80 billion in assets under management (AUM) by July 10, 2025, making it the fastest-growing ETF in history, as reported by official data.

BlackRock Bitcoin ETF Reaches $80 Billion AUM Milestone

This event highlights BlackRock’s significant role in advancing cryptocurrency derivatives and showcases explosive growth in institutional Bitcoin adoption.

The BlackRock iShares Bitcoin Trust (IBIT), operated by BlackRock, reached a historic milestone, amassing $80 billion AUM. With 706,000 BTC held, it positions BlackRock as a leader in the Bitcoin ETF sector. Experts like James Seyffart highlight the unprecedented growth of this ETF. Institutional involvement has surged, with significant inflows confirming Bitcoin’s standing in traditional finance.

“IBIT’s growth is unprecedented. It’s the fastest ETF to reach most milestones, faster than any other ETF in any asset class.” — James Seyffart, ETF Analyst, Bloomberg

Immediate market effects are evident, as Bitcoin trades above $118,000. This significant price rise highlights increased confidence in digital assets. Institutional inflows suggest long-term confidence in crypto as an asset class, with significant implications on market liquidity. The ETF’s growth impacts BTC directly, rallying other cryptocurrencies like ETH and AAVE. While the broader market reacts positively, concerns about regulatory scrutiny persist. BlackRock’s compliance under SEC guidelines remains critical, underscoring the ETF’s legal framing.

Potential regulatory reactions and future technological shifts can reshape institutional cryptocurrency strategies. Experts anticipate further financial sector evolution, with other firms striving to replicate BlackRock’s success. The trend may lead to increased market capitalization for cryptocurrencies, promoting widespread adoption.
